 Facility Location: A Survey of Applications and Methods by Z. Drezner, Facility location is concerned with the siting of one or more facilities in a way that optimizes certain objectives such as minimizing transportation costs, providing equitable service to customers, or minimizing the time taken to deliver emergency services. This handbook presents a wide-ranging survey of location analysis. Both researchers in the subject and practitioners concerned with the solution of real-world problems will find this an up-to-date and comprehensive volume which addresses all the major methods and applications in the field. Each chapter has been written by an expert on that particular topic, and the editor has taken care to ensure a uniformity of style and notation throughout. The book is organized into four parts: Methodology and analysis of facility location.- Various objectives in facility location.- Competitive facility location.- Routing and location.
 Anglican Religious Communities Year Book by Canterbury Press, Because the Anglican Church has long understood the value of taking time apart from the routine of life, established religious communities have generously offered their facilities as places of respite for individuals and groups. Designed as a resource for clergy and laity who are looking for retreat facilities and for all those interested in the religious life, the Year Book provides a detailed directory of Anglican religious communities all over the world. Included in each entry are location, telephone and fax numbers, e-mail address, a history and description of the facility, service schedules, accommodations, special programs offered, names of community publications, and a variety of other information. The Year Book, with a foreword written by The Most Rev. Frank T. Griswold, Presiding Bishop of the Episcopal Church, also offers a selection of articles on religious life. Indexes of the communities by dedication or patron saint, by geographical location, and by initials, in addition to a helpful glossary, serve to make this guide extremely easy to use.
Address book - An address book or a name and address book (NAB) is a book or a collection of data storing contact details (for example: address, telephone number, e-mail address, fax number, mobile phone number). Most such systems store the details in alphabetical order of people's names, although in paper-based address books entries can easily end up out of order as the owner inserts details of more individuals or as people move. Address Book - Address Book is an address book software application made by Apple Computer that runs only in Mac OS X.
